当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

一个服务器多个网址,如何在一个服务器上绑定多个域名,实现多个网站共存

一个服务器多个网址,如何在一个服务器上绑定多个域名,实现多个网站共存

在一个服务器上绑定多个域名实现多网站共存,可通过以下步骤:配置服务器IP地址,将多个域名解析至该IP;为每个域名创建相应的虚拟主机配置文件;确保所有网站内容分别放置在各...

在一个服务器上绑定多个域名实现多网站共存,可通过以下步骤:配置服务器IP地址,将多个域名解析至该IP;为每个域名创建相应的虚拟主机配置文件;确保所有网站内容分别放置在各自域名对应的目录中。

随着互联网的快速发展,许多企业或个人都希望能够拥有自己的网站,由于各种原因,他们往往只能购买一台服务器,在这种情况下,如何在一个服务器上绑定多个域名,实现多个网站共存成为一个值得探讨的问题,本文将为您详细介绍如何在同一服务器上绑定多个域名,并实现多个网站共存。

服务器环境准备

在开始绑定域名之前,我们需要确保服务器环境满足以下要求:

  1. 服务器已安装Web服务器软件,如Apache、Nginx等;
  2. 服务器已配置SSL证书(如HTTPS网站);
  3. 服务器已开启相应的端口(如80、443等);
  4. 服务器空间足够存放多个网站的数据。

域名解析

  1. 购买域名:您需要购买多个域名,您可以选择国内外的域名注册商进行购买。

    一个服务器多个网址,如何在一个服务器上绑定多个域名,实现多个网站共存

    图片来源于网络,如有侵权联系删除

  2. 域名解析:将购买的域名解析到您的服务器IP地址,具体操作如下:

(1)登录域名解析服务商的官网; (2)找到域名解析管理页面; (3)添加解析记录,记录类型为A记录或CNAME记录,记录值为您的服务器IP地址; (4)保存解析设置。

绑定域名

配置Web服务器:

(1)Apache服务器:

在Apache服务器中,每个网站都需要一个虚拟主机配置文件,您可以在“/etc/apache2/sites-available/”目录下创建一个新的配置文件,如“example.com.conf”。

在配置文件中,设置以下内容:

<VirtualHost *:80> ServerAdmin webmaster@example.com ServerName example.com ServerAlias www.example.com DocumentRoot /var/www/example.com ErrorLog ${APACHE_LOG_DIR}/error.log CustomLog ${APACHE_LOG_DIR}/access.log combined

(2)Nginx服务器:

在Nginx服务器中,每个网站也需要一个配置文件,您可以在“/etc/nginx/sites-available/”目录下创建一个新的配置文件,如“example.com.conf”。

在配置文件中,设置以下内容:

server { listen 80; server_name example.com www.example.com; root /var/www/example.com; index index.html index.htm; location / { try_files $uri $uri/ =404; } }

启用虚拟主机配置:

(1)Apache服务器:

在“/etc/apache2/sites-enabled/”目录下,创建一个指向新配置文件的符号链接,如:

一个服务器多个网址,如何在一个服务器上绑定多个域名,实现多个网站共存

图片来源于网络,如有侵权联系删除

ln -s /etc/apache2/sites-available/example.com.conf /etc/apache2/sites-enabled/example.com.conf

(2)Nginx服务器:

将新配置文件复制到“/etc/nginx/sites-enabled/”目录下,如:

cp /etc/nginx/sites-available/example.com.conf /etc/nginx/sites-enabled/example.com.conf

重启Web服务器:

(1)Apache服务器:

service apache2 restart

(2)Nginx服务器:

systemctl restart nginx

配置SSL证书(可选)

如果您需要配置HTTPS网站,请按照以下步骤操作:

  1. 购买SSL证书或使用Let's Encrypt免费证书;
  2. 将SSL证书上传到服务器;
  3. 修改Web服务器配置文件,添加SSL配置;
  4. 重启Web服务器。

测试网站

在浏览器中输入您绑定的域名,如果能够正常访问网站,则说明绑定域名成功。

通过以上步骤,您可以在一个服务器上绑定多个域名,实现多个网站共存,在实际操作过程中,您可能需要根据具体情况调整配置,以适应不同的网站需求,希望本文能对您有所帮助。

黑狐家游戏

发表评论

最新文章